🚀 operative.sh web-eval-agent MCP サーバー
コーディングエージェントに自己デバッグを任せれば、もっとやるべきことがあるはずです。

🔥 デバッグを強化
operative.shの MCP サーバーは、ブラウザベースのエージェントを起動して、コード エディター内で直接 Web アプリを自律的に実行およびデバッグします。
⚡ 特徴
🌐 BrowserUse を使用してウェブアプリを操作する(操作可能なバックエンドで 2 倍高速化)
📊ネットワークトラフィックをキャプチャ- リクエストはインテリジェントにフィルタリングされ、コンテキストウィンドウに返されます
🚨コンソールエラーを収集- ログとエラーをキャプチャします
🤖自律デバッグ- カーソル エージェントは Web QA エージェント mcp サーバーを呼び出して、書き込んだコードがエンドツーエンドで期待どおりに動作するかどうかをテストします。
🧰 MCP ツールリファレンス
道具 | 目的 |
| 🤖 ブラウザを操作し、スクリーンショット、コンソールとネットワークのログをキャプチャし、豊富な UX レポートを返す自動 UX エバリュエーター。 |
| 🔒 対話型 (非ヘッドレス) ブラウザを開いて一度サインインできるようにします。保存された Cookie/ローカル ストレージは、後続の
実行で再利用されます。 |
主な議論
web_eval_agenturl(必須) – 実行中のアプリのアドレス (例http://localhost:3000)task(必須) - テスト対象についての自然言語による説明(「サインアップフローを実行し、UX の問題があればメモする」)headless_browser(オプション、デフォルトは – ブラウザウィンドウを非表示にするにはtrueに設定します
setup_browser_stateurl(オプション) – 最初に開くページ (ログイン画面に直接アクセスするのに便利)
これらのツールは、IDE チャットから直接起動できます。たとえば、次のようになります。
🏁 クイックスタート (macOS/Linux)
前提条件(通常は必要ありません):
醸造:
/b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"npm: (
brew install npm)jq:
brew install jq
APIキー(無料)を取得した後、インストーラーを実行します。
お気に入りのIDEにアクセスし、再起動して変更を適用します
チャットモードでプロンプトを送信して、Web評価エージェントツールを呼び出します。例:
🛠️ 手動インストール
operative.shでAPIキーを取得します
Playwright をインストールします:
以下のJSONをAPIキーとともに関連するコードエディターに追加します。
コードエディタを再起動します
🔃 更新中
uv cache cleanMCPサーバーを更新する
オペレーティブDiscordサーバー
🛠️ 手動インストール (Mac + Cursor/Cline/Windsurf)
operative.shでAPIキーを取得します
Playwright をインストールします:
以下のJSONをAPIキーとともに関連するコードエディターに追加します。
コードエディタを再起動してください
手動インストール(Windows + カーソル/クライン/ウィンドサーフィン)
これを改良中です。問題がある場合は、問題を報告してください。
これをすべてコードエディタターミナルで実行します
curl -LSf https://operative.sh/install.sh -o install.sh && bash install.sh && rm install.shoperative.shでAPIキーを取得します
uv をインストールします
(curl -LsSf https://astral.sh/uv/install.sh | sh)uvx --from git+https://github.com/Operative-Sh/web-eval-agent.git playwright installコードエディターを再起動
🚨 問題点
コードエディターで更新が受信されない場合、最新バージョンに更新または再インストールしてください。最新のバージョンにするには
uv cache clean実行してください。何か問題がございましたら、お気軽にこのリポジトリまたは discord で Issue を開いてください。
5/5 - 変更のない静的アプリがスクリーンキャストされない問題を修正しました。UV
uv cleanと再起動で修正されます。
変更履歴
4/29 - エージェントオーバーレイの更新 - ブラウザでエージェントの実行を一時停止/再生/停止
📋 MCP サーバー出力レポートの例
スターの歴史
<3 @ operative.shで構築
Related MCP Servers
- Asecurity-licenseAqualityEnables browser automation for LLMs on Linux display servers, supporting web interaction, screenshots, and JavaScript execution in a real browser.Last updated -707
- Asecurity-licenseAqualityProvides LLM Agents with AI-powered mentorship for code review, design critique, writing feedback, and brainstorming using the Deepseek API, enabling enhanced output in various development and strategic planning tasks.Last updated -32Apache 2.0
- -security-license-qualityAI-powered agent that streamlines web testing workflows by allowing developers to record, execute, and discover tests using natural language prompts in their AI coding assistants.Last updated -59Apache 2.0
- Asecurity-licenseAqualityProvides AI assistants with Safari browser automation and developer tools access, enabling LLMs to control Safari, access console logs, monitor network activity, and perform browser automation tasks.Last updated -1359MIT License